8.3 Lubricating the Lift

The Invacare lift is designed for minimum maintenance. However,
a six month check and lubrication should ensure continued safety
and reliability.
Keep lift and slings clean and in good working order. Any defect
should be noted and reported to your Dealer as soon as possible.
Refer to the figure for lubrication points. Lubricate all pivot points
with a light grease (waterproof auto lubricant). Wipe all excess
lubricant from lift surface.

8.4 Detecting Wear and Damage

It is important to inspect all stressed parts, such as slings, hanger bar
and any pivot for slings for signs of cracking, fraying, deformation or
deterioration. Replace any defective parts immediately and ensure
that the lift is not used until repairs are made.

8.5 Cleaning the Sling and Lift

The sling should be regularly washed in water, temperature not to
exceed 180°F (82°C), and a biocidal (anti-biological) solution. A soft
cloth, dampened with water and a small amount of mild detergent,
is all that is needed to clean the patient lift. The lift can be cleaned
with non-abrasive cleaners.

8.6 Maintaining the Manual/Hydraulic Pump

All parts of the Manual/Hydraulic Pump are precision machined, then
carefully assembled and tested to ensure reliable service. The pump
assembly is completely enclosed and sealed with neoprene rings to
prevent leakage of hydraulic oil. A small amount of oil (about a drop)
will accumulate around the piston from time to time and should be
removed with a facial tissue.
WARNING!
– The pump is sealed at the factory. DO NOT attempt
to open the pump or obtain local service as this will
void the warranty and might result in damage and
costly repair. Consult your dealer or write Invacare
for further information.
